Authors Talk including Lin-Manuel Miranda

  • June 15, 2021
  • 7:00 PM - 8:00 PM
  • Online, Anderson's Bookshop

Join Anderson's Bookshops, in partnership with the American Booksellers Association and Random House, for a virtual one-night event to launch In The Heights: Finding Home with authors Lin-Manuel Miranda, Quiara Alegría Hudes, and Jeremy McCarter!

Join for what will surely be an unforgettable conversation on creativity, community, and the power of finding home. Twenty years ago, way before the phenomenon of Hamilton, this is where it all began. Miranda was a kid with a dream: Could he share the story of Washington Heights in all its glory—the people, the music, the home that shaped him? Guests will have the unique experience of hearing from the creative team behind this timeless story of how one neighborhood can speak to the whole world.

About cgcc

The Chicago Gifted Community Center (CGCC) is a member-driven 501(c)(3) non-profit organization created by parents to support the intellectual and emotional growth of gifted children and their families.
